Conductor Nahan Franko (1861-1930) in background. Franko was Concertmaster of the Metropolitan Opera Orchestra (1883 to 1907). A violinist, Nahan made his debut at age 8 at Steinway Hall in New York City and then toured with Adelina Patti as a child prodigy. [1]
